Clare Chatfield has over 25 years of consulting experience working for both French and international corporate clients. She covers a broad range of industrial sectors, including energy & environment, infrastructure, transport and mobility, logistics and distribution, and business services. Clare has particular expertise in the rapidly growing areas of energy efficiency, smart power, energy storage and the circular economy.

Clare assists customers in defining their strategy and identifying the principal operational and organizational levers for its successful activation. She regularly provides strategic advice around the role of technology and the digital economy in accelerating change.

Clare completed her undergraduate degree at Cambridge University and a Master of Business Administration at INSEAD.

Education

Undergraduate: Master of Arts, Cambridge University

Graduate: Master of Business Administration, INSEAD

Clare Chatfield

Clare's Expertise

Read more

Related Insights